Corbins contract terms are not publicly known, but university tax return records showed he made $1.2 million in base salary in 2019 with $234,500 in bonuses, making him among the highest-paid coaches in college baseball. However, they must file a 990 federal tax return about 18 months after the reported calendar year, which was obtained by The Tennessean. Vanderbilt's Tim Corbin: $1.2 million (this was Corbin's base salary for 2019 calendar year, according to the school's most recent federal tax records. At Clemson, he worked under head coach Jack Leggett, on the same staff with future head coaches and SEC rivals Kevin O'Sullivan and John Pawlowski.
